Modelling scout linked to Epstein found dead in Paris suburbs
Prosecutors opened a cause-of-death inquiry as Daniel Siad faced trial over accusations he helped Jeffrey Epstein recruit and abuse women.
- On Wednesday, French prosecutors announced that Daniel Siad, a modeling scout linked to American financier Jeffrey Epstein, was found dead at his home in Colombes, west of Paris.
- Siad was under investigation in France for allegedly aiding Epstein in trafficking and abusing women, though he denied the accusations and sought to provide his own account to investigators.
- Accusations against Siad include rape, as alleged by a former Swedish model, and his name appears in more than 1,000 records linked to Epstein's network according to declassified documents.
- Lisa Brinkworth, co-founder of Victorious Angels, expressed shock at the news. "It is devastating that the survivors in the Brunel case were first denied justice, and now those in the Siad case," she told AFP.
- An investigation to determine the cause of death was opened on Monday evening following the discovery, the Nanterre prosecutor's office added. This death follows those of Epstein in 2019 and Brunel in 2022, both facing sex trafficking charges.
